Gold Coast unit prices have overtaken Sydney's for the first time, marking a significant milestone for the Queensland coastal market that
was once considered an affordable alternative to Australia's largest city.
Ray White Group Chief Economist, Nerida Conisbee, revealed that Gold Coast units now command a median price of $956,000,
edging past Sydney's $927,000, though Sydney remains the nation's most expensive city for houses.
"The recent surge in apartment values shows just how strong demand has become in south-east Queensland," Ms Conisbee said.
"Gold Coast house and unit prices are climbing again after briefly slowing mid-year, driven by population growth, easing rates, and a
persistent shortage of new homes."
Ms Conisbee pointed to several factors fuelling this strong growth, including the impact of interest rate cuts. "Three rate cuts so
far this year have provided a meaningful boost to borrowing capacity, and markets are now pricing in a possible fourth in November,"
she said.
Migration continues to play a crucial role in the region's property boom, with the Gold Coast attracting residents from across Australia and
internationally. "The region is attracting new residents from across Australia and overseas, drawn by lifestyle, climate, and improving
infrastructure," Ms Conisbee said. "Population growth in the Gold Coast and broader southeast Queensland remains among the fastest
in the country, yet new housing supply is failing to keep pace."
According to Ms Conisbee, the city has undergone a remarkable transformation over the past five years, with luxury coastal development
driving much of the price growth. "Main Beach now leads the city, with a median unit price of $1.73 million following a $880,000 rise
over the past decade," she said. "Close behind are Burleigh Heads and Palm Beach, where median unit prices have climbed by
$760,000 and $740,000 respectively. Currumbin-Tugun has also surged, with prices up 134 per cent over the decade."
The data reveals a broad strength across the city's prime coastal corridor, with suburbs including Miami, Coolangatta, Mermaid Waters,
and Paradise Point all recording substantial gains between $670,000 and $700,000 since 2015. Ms Conisbee identified downsizers and
interstate buyers as key drivers of demand in the premium market. "Demand is being led by downsizers and interstate buyers from
Sydney and Melbourne who are willing to pay premium prices for waterfront living," she said.
"Developers have responded with a wave of high-end apartment projects offering resort-style amenities and large floorplates, a
product now synonymous with the modern Gold Coast skyline."
Construction challenges remain a significant factor in the market's supply constraints, particularly for affordable housing options.
"While construction costs are starting to moderate nationally, they remain high in Queensland, limiting the viability of lower-priced
developments," Ms Conisbee said. "This means new stock under $750,000 is now almost impossible to deliver without significant
incentives or planning flexibility."
The market is seeing increased activity from both investors and first-home buyers, with investor lending in Queensland reaching record
levels. "Rising rents and tight vacancy rates continue to attract investors seeking both income and capital growth potential," she
said. "A growing number of first-home buyers are turning to the city's apartment market, where smaller holiday units are being
converted into permanent homes."
